The slimy water in the can of chickpeas is called Aquafaba and it can be whipped into peaks like a merringue(and baked hard) or left smooth and used as a mayonnaise/dressing substitute and a bunch of other things.
I'm not a big fan of substitutions but since I'm using cans of chickpeas anyways it's kinda cool to make stuff with it.
